Baltimore Heritage, Inc.
Baltimore Heritage, Inc. is a nonprofit organization located at 100 North Charles Street in Baltimore, Maryland, United States. As a tourist attraction, we are dedicated to saving historic buildings and revitalizing neighborhoods in the city. Our mission is to celebrate the stories of Baltimore's people and places through tours and education. We support home-owners and neighborhood organizations in their efforts to preserve and restore their homes and local landmarks. Our staff and board are committed to promoting historic preservation with residents, neighborhoods, and property owners across the city. We offer a range of history education and outreach programs to celebrate Baltimore's rich architectural and social heritage. With nearly 70 designated historic districts containing over 50,000 residential and commercial buildings, we provide resources to help save and preserve Baltimore's historic district. Patagonia
Patagonia is a clothing store located at 700 South Caroline Street in Baltimore, Maryland, United States. Customers can save up to 50% on past-season products by shopping online. Orders are shipped within 1-2 business days and arrive within 3-10 business days, with flexible shipping options available for those concerned about the environmental impact. The 15,000 square foot Patagonia store is the largest yet, housed in a fully remodeled brick & steel building constructed in 1882. This historic building was originally built by the EJ Codd Company, a boiler manufacturer. Patagonia is excited to repurpose a part of Baltimore's industrial past and offer a wide selection of current and past-season clothing and gear at outlet prices.

Regional Economic Studies Institute (RESI) at Towson University
The Regional Economic Studies Institute (RESI) at Towson University, located at 401 Washington Avenue in Towson, Maryland, is a trusted expert on Maryland's economy. With over 25 years of experience, RESI offers a wide range of economic and policy analysis services to public, private, and nonprofit organizations throughout Maryland and the region. As economic factors and public policy continue to evolve, RESI is dedicated to expanding its services and expertise to meet the needs of its partners. Established in 1989 at the University of Baltimore and later moving to Towson University in 1996, RESI has become the leading expert on Maryland's economy. Its team of economists and researchers provides high-quality service with an interdisciplinary approach that combines knowledge, methodology, and technology.

Amir Miodovnik
Amir Miodovnik is a physician who practices at the Center for Development and Learning at Kennedy Krieger Institute in Baltimore, Maryland. He is also an assistant professor in the Department of Pediatrics at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ine. Dr. Miodovnik has an impressive educational background, having attended the University of Virginia, The Ohio State University College of Medicine, and completing his pediatric residency at Lurie Children's Hospital of Chicago and Northwestern University’s Feinberg School of Medicine. He has also served in the US Navy as a Lieutenant Commander in Okinawa, Japan, and volunteered as a field doctor for Médecins Sans Frontières and Project Medishare. Dr. Miodovnik has conducted extensive research on the effects of prenatal exposure to industrial chemicals and pesticides on neurodevelopment, as well as the impact of endocrine disruptors on childhood behavior. He has published numerous articles in reputable medical journals and is dedicated to providing high-quality care to his patients. Dr. George T. Capone, MD
Dr. George T. Capone, MD is a renowned research scientist and director of the Down Syndrome Clinic and Research Center (DSCRC) at Kennedy Krieger Institute in Baltimore, Maryland. He is also an associate professor of pediatrics at the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ine. Dr. Capone is dedicated to studying the neurobiologic basis of cognitive impairment and associated neurobehavioral and psychiatric disorders in individuals with Down syndrome. Located at 707 North Broadway, Baltimore, Maryland, Dr. Capone's institution provides comprehensive care and research opportunities for individuals with Down syndrome. The clinic offers medical services, research studies, and treatment options for patients with this genetic disorder, which affects approximately 1 in 733 live births.
Dr. Cecilia T. Davoli, MD
Dr. Cecilia T. Davoli, MD is a renowned developmental pediatrician located at 707 North Broadway in Baltimore, Maryland, United States. Dr. Davoli serves as an associate professor in pediatrics at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ine and The Johns Hopkins University School of Hygiene and Public Health. She graduated from the College of William and Mary in 1980 with a bachelor's degree in biology and obtained her medical degree from Georgetown University School of Medicine in 1987. Dr. Davoli completed her residency in pediatrics at the University of Virginia Medical Center and a fellowship in developmental pediatrics at Kennedy Krieger Institute. She also holds a master's degree in public health from Johns Hopkins University. Dr. Davoli is a fellow of the American Academy of Pediatrics and a member of various organizations including the Kennedy Fellows Association, Society for Developmental Pediatrics, and the American Academy of Cerebral Palsy and Developmental Medicine. She is board certified in pediatrics and neurodevelopmental disabilities. Dr. Davoli has been working at Kennedy Krieger Institute since 1990 and currently serves as the outpatient medical director.
